Le Livre I du Code de droit canonique constitue la "Constitution technique" de l'Église. En 203 canons, il fixe les normes générales, la création des lois, la notion de personne et l'usage de la dispense. Cet ensemble juridique garantit une gouvernance pastorale juste et souple au service de l'ensemble des baptisés.
